1-pentene will be formed as major product when methoxide reacts with

A.2-iodopentane
B.3-iodopentane
C.2-fluoropentane✓ Correct
D.3-fluoropentae
Explanation

1-pentene will be formed as major product when methoxide reacts with 2-fluoropentane. In this case fluoride ion is leaving group so major product is least substituted alkene.
